V...............................................The Easter Egg List VI...................................................The Point List VII......................................................In Closing VIII.................................................Special Thanks IX......................................................FAQ History X.............................................Copyright Information ======================================================================= |-I.------------------------ INTRODUCTION ----------------------------| ======================================================================= This document is a complete walkthrough for the classic Sierra adventure game "Space Quest: The Sarien Encounter". In this game you play as Roger Wilco, the janitor of the Starship Arcada. Your goal is to save yourself and maybe the rest of the world from the Sariens. This will never do. ======================================================================= |-III.----------------------- THE CONTROLS ---------------------------| ======================================================================= This game uses a "parser interface", which means you have to tell the game exactly what to do via typing in commands. When you hit any letter of the alphabet, a small white box will appear on screen. In that box you type what you want the character to do. If you want to look around, you type LOOK and press enter. Moving with the arrow keys is pretty self-explanatory but just incase, =-Right Direction Key-= Starts Roger walking toward the right side of the screen. =-Left Direction Key-= Starts Roger walking toward the left side of the screen. =-Up Direction Key Starts Roger walking toward the top of the screen. =-Down Direction Key-= Starts Roger walking toward the bottom of the screen. To stop walking, just press the key direction key again. Here are some more commands you'll need to know: =-ESC-= Brings up the menu bar at the top of the screen, this action also pauses the game. =-F1-= Brings up a little help menu. =-F2-= Brings up the sound controls. =-F3-= Brings up the last thing you typed in a white text box. =-F5-= Brings up the Save Game menu. =-F7-= Brings up the Restore Game menu. =-F9-= Brings up the Restart Game menu. =-TAB-= Brings up the Inventory screen. =-Ctrl+J-= Sets up your joystick. =-Ctrl+R-= Toggles your monitor settings. =-Alt+Z-= Quits the game. ======================================================================= |-IV.---------------------- THE WALKTHROUGH --------------------------| ======================================================================= Remember, save early and save often... =-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-= 1. Aboard the Spaceship Arcada =-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-= (This level begins with Roger Wilco, you, stumbling out of a broom closet. Red lights flashing on each floor act as a constant reminder to keep moving. You have to get off of this ship before it blows up, while at the same time keeping an eye out for the evil Sarien invaders. Lucky for you, I know the way out.) Walk left three screens. Type SEARCH BODY Type TAKE KEYCARD Go right two screens and wait a few seconds inside of this room. (After while, an injured old man will stumble through the door on the right and slump down on the floor.) Type LOOK AT MAN (The old man will tell you that the ship is under attack and the Star Generator project is in jeopardy. He advises you to escape as soon as possible, and then with his last breath points to the shelf behind you and says "astral body".) Walk up to the blue and purple robot and type LOOK AT SCREEN. (You'll get a view of the screen of the console, and be asked to name a title.) Type ASTRAL BODY into the computer and press ENTER. (The robot will search the records for that cartridge, and then retrieve it for you) Type TAKE CARTRIDGE Walk left one screen and enter the elevator. Once on the lower floor, walk right one screen and enter the elevator. Once you get to the bottom floor, walk right one screen. Walk up to the control panel on the upper right. Type PRESS OPEN BAY DOOR Go right one screen and approach the panel to the left of the door. Type USE KEYCARD Enter the door to your right. In this room, walk up to the two small white squares on the back wall. Type PRESS LEFT BUTTON Type GET THE GADGET (You'll pick up a small, mysterious device) Type PRESS RIGHT BUTTON Type PICK UP SUIT (You are now wearing a space suit, and you've put your old janitor's clothes in their place in the closet) Walk up to the small control panel on the bottom of the screen. Type PUSH AIRLOCK BUTTON Walk through the door on the left that you just opened. Walk up to the small control panel you see just as you enter this room and type PUSH PLATFORM BUTTON Walk up to the ship you just brought up and type ENTER POD (You are now seated in the small escape pod, with the camera moving to a behind-the-head view) Type BUCKLE SEAT BELT Type PRESS POWER BUTTON Type PRESS AUTONAV BUTTON Type PULL THROTTLE (You have turned on the auto-nav, so now the navigational computer will take you to the nearest planet. Congratulations you have escaped the Starship Arcada, and have started your descent onto the desert planet of Kerona.) 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 =-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-= 2. The Planet of Kerona =-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-= (Now you find yourself sitting in the cockpit of your once great escape pod. All of the controls are damaged beyond repair, and the windshield is shattered into a million pieces. It looks like its first space voyage was also its last. Ashes to ashes, and dust to dust, we just have to move on with our lives. Take note that this planet is very dry and hot, so Roger will get thirsty very easily. Whenever the game talks about Roger being dry, type DRINK WATER. You'll die if you don't!) Type PICK UP KIT Type UNBUCKLE SEATBELT Type GET OUT Walk up to the front of the crashed pod and type PICK UP GLASS (You just picked up a piece of highly reflective glass from the shattered remains of the windshield) Walk right three screens. On the third screen, step up onto the yellow stone ramp and go up one screen. (About halfway up the ramp, a spider droid will drop down from the sky and begin moving around. This robot was send down to find you and destroy you. It should be avoided at all costs.) Take the ramp left on the second screen up. Walk across the fragile bridge and stop at the large round brown object. Type PUSH ROCK when the robot is on the third brown line from the bottom of the screen. (You'll destroy the robot for good. It's not necessary to complete the game, but it is the only way to get 100% of the points. Also it's one less thing for Roger to worry about.) Follow the yellow ramp left one, up one, and right two. When you come to the dead end, step underneath the broken archway. (You'll suddenly take a ride down a mysterious elevator shaft, and into a subterranean cavern.) Step out of the elevator and over to the upper area of the screen. Type PICK UP ROCK Go left one screen. (In his room you see a large purple metal grate, followed by steam coming from a stalagmite. There is a monster hiding just under the grate, and he'll grab you in you step onto it. Luckily, the way around this problem is really simple.) Walk as far up to the north rock wall as possible, and then go left. (You'll stay just out of reach of the monster's green tentacles) Now, walk up to the steaming rock and type PUT ROCK IN HOLE (The door to the left of you will open) Walk through the door you just opened. From here, you have to go to the very top of the screen, and then go straight left to move to the next screen. Walk up to the red and white light beams, but DO NOT go through them. Instead, type PUT GLASS IN BEAMS. (The reflective surface of the glass reflected the lasers onto their own generators, completely destroying the device and clearing the path for you.) Now, walk up the stone ramp and right two screens. (To make it past the dripping acid, stay as close to the upper rock wall as possible.) Type TURN ON GADGET, and then walk right one more screen. (This gadget will translate the alien language you will hear in the next room) (Now you find yourself in a dark room with a large sinister looking head. Just listen to what he has to say. Your mission is to kill the Orat, and bring back some evidence you got the job done. With your mission clearly laid out, you tumble out of the cave and back to the sandy surface) Now, walk down the yellow stone ramp the same way you came up it. When you reach the bottom, walk up one screen. Walk right one screen into the large black cave. Quickly type THROW WATER AT ORAT (You throw the canister at him, and he swallows it. The canister is pressurized, so it's puncture causes a massive explosion inside his stomach. Now he's dead, and you can move on.) Walk over to the small orange object on the right side of the screen and type PICK UP PART Walk left one screen to exit the cave. Walk down one screen, and then climb onto and go back up the yellow stone ramp. Step under the broken archway again so you can re-enter the underground cavern. Once down there, return to the room with the huge alien head the same way you got there the first time. (The lasers are gone, but the acid drops are still there so be careful) When you get to the room with the big head, type DROP PART When the large white triangle comes into view, walk into it. (You now see the true nature of the mysterious being; it's just a hologram. You are now in the engine room of the underground structure. There is a computer console in here, and to you right is the transportation you were promised.) Walk up to the computer console that is straight ahead. Type PUT CARTRIDGE IN SLOT (You'll finally be treated to the information stored in the cartridge. It concerns the Star Generator, and I've re-printed the message below incase you missed any of it.) _____________________________________________________________________ | | | Whoever shall read this: My name is Dr. Slash Vohaul, I am a | | scientist with The Star Generator Project aboard the Starlab Arcada.| | | | We have just successfully completed development an testing of the | | Star Generator. During this time I have come to believe that our | | progress has been monitored by others. I fear that the Sariens may | | have learned of our mission. | | | | If my fears prove true, The Star Generator and the people of our | | universe are in serious jeopardy. The Star Generator is a miraculous| | device. Used as intended, it will help preserve life for eons to | | come. Used as a device of evil, it would cause the destruction of | | millions of lives and enslave all who oppose the Sariens. | | | | Encoded within this cartridge are all the plans and specifications | | for the Star Generator. Should any disaster befall the Star | | Generator, scientists would be able to create a duplicate of the | | Star Generator with this information. | | | | Please guard it with your life and return it to the Xenon ruling | | body as quickly as possible. | | | | Important Note: | | The Star Generator is capable of self-destruction. This was | | introduced to the system as a precaution. To activate it one must | | enter the code 6858. | | | | A five-minute time will begin to count down. Beware, anyone within | | 5 kilometers of the Star Generator will be in danger once the timer | | has been initiated. Please be careful and GOOD LUCK! | |_____________________________________________________________________| When you're done reading it, type TAKE CARTRIDGE Now, walk over to the small sand skimmer on the right side of the screen. Type GET IN SKIMMER Type TURN KEY (Now you start your adventure-filled ride to the Ulence Flats. The ground is littered with rocks, which will damage the skimmer if you hit them. So, I would suggest setting the game speed to slow to make it as easy as possible.) 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 =-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-= 3. The Settlement on the Ulence Flats =-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-= (After your wild boulder-filled ride through the desert you finally reach your destination, the Ulence Flats. You pull up outside a local bar to your right, and to your left is what appears to be a used spaceship store. Maybe they can find a more permanent solution to your transportation problem.) Type GET OUT OF SKIMMER Type Get KEY (Taking the key out of the ignition will prevent it from being stolen. And just after you do this, a man will walk up and make you an offer on your sand skimmer.) Type NO to refuse his first offer. (Don't worry, his next one will be better.) Walk left one screen, and then right one screen to return to your skimmer. (The man will once again walk up to you and make a final offer for your skimmer.) Type YES to accept his second and final offer. (Congratulations, you just made 30 buckazoids and got a used jetpack.) Enter into the bar on your right. Walk up to the far corner of the bar and wait for the bartender to ask what you want to drink up, and then type BEER When he serves you, type DRINK BEER Repeat that two more times. (On the third time you will overhear a conversation that will give you the coordinates to your next destination. Apparently, one of the local patrons has witnessed first hand the destructive power of the Star Generator.) Now, walk away from the counter and up to the slot machine on the right side of the bar. (This is where you will make enough money to purchase a ship off of this planet.) The best strategy here is to first SAVE the game, and then start playing. If you lose money, RESTORE your old game; if you win money, SAVE your game. Whatever you do, don't win past 249 buckazoids. If you do, the machine will blow and you won't get to use it again. When you've made about 225 buckazoids, press F10 to leave the machine and then walk out of the bar. Walk left one screen and talk to Tiny, the used spaceship salesman. Then, walk up one screen and over to the spaceship. After Tiny tells you about this little spacecraft and gives you a purchase price, type BUY THIS SPACESHIP (This is the ship you will leave this planet in, but first you need to earn some more money so you can purchase a droid to help you navigate.) Walk right one screen. Walk behind the corner of the building and type PICK UP BUCKAZOIDS (You just picked up 5 hidden buckazoids, which will make your work with the slot machine a little easier.) Walk down one screen, and then enter the bar. Wait around until the laser zaps the alien currently playing the slot machine, and then walk right up to it. Play the machine again, and this time you don't need to be afraid to win as much money as possible. When you've "broken the bank", exit the bar and walk up one screen. (Ignore the alien that walks up to you and offers a mode of transportation. He is really just going to mug you if you follow him.) Then, go right one screen and enter the "Droids B Us" store. Walk up the stairs on the right side of the screen and up to the robot closed to you. When he the salesman is done explaining it to you, type BUY THIS DROID Now, walk out of the store and left two screens. (The droid will follow you to your ship.) Walk up to the black ladder that is leading to the cockpit of your newly purchased ship and type CLIMB LADDER Once inside, type PRESS LOAD BUTTON (The droid will be raised into the ship so that he can help you navigate the ship) When he asks what sector he should target, type HH (The droid will take over control of your ship and lift off of the planet Kerona. As you rise above the sandy surface and off into space, you catch a glimpse of something that makes you question your recent purchase. Anyway...) 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 =-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-= 4. Attack on the Sarien Battle Cruiser =-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-=-= (After some quick evasive maneuvers through an asteroid field, no thanks to you I might add, you begin your approach to the Sarien battle cruiser the Deltaur. Inside this massive spacecraft is the Star Generator and the alien race that has stolen it. You have to stop them from using it as the ultimate weapon, anyway you can!) Type PUT ON JETPACK Type GET OUT OF SHIP Use the arrow-keys to move right up to the door in the middle of the screen. Type OPEN DOOR Then, use the arrow-keys to coast into the ship. When you get inside, walk over to the right side of the doorway and wait. When a robot walks through the door and has its back to you, quickly run through the door and into the next room. In this room, walk over to the left side of the small black box and type OPEN CHEST. Then, type GET IN CHEST (You'll climb into the chest and close the lid over your head. After a few seconds, unseen people will carry by into another room of the ship. Then, you wait until the voices fade away and you feel you are alone. Also, somehow through the course of your little ride you have lost possession of the jetpack) Type GET OUT OF CHEST Now, walk up to the small black circle in the middle of the back wall and type OPEN DOOR Then, type CLIMB INTO MACHINE (You will make the decision to climb into the washing machine, where you will soon be joined by a set of guard's clothes. After a quick little spin around the machine, you feel somewhat different about yourself.) Type GET OUT OF THE MACHINE (Surprise, surprise, you just dawned the guard's uniform. Lucky for you; you may now move freely about the ship.) Type LOOK AT UNIFORM (Your quick search through the pockets of this uniform will reveal an ID card. From now on you will be known as Buston Freem. Enjoy!) Go through the door to your right. Once in that room, wait for a green alien to walk in from the right and then approach him. Type TALK TO THE GUARD. (This isn't necessary to complete the game, but it is necessary if you want to get all of the game points.) Now, type KISS THE GUARD (Same explanation as before.) Now, keep talking to the guard until he asks you if you have ever played "Kings Quest III". When he does, type YES. (Again, same explanation as the previous two directions.) Then, walk into the elevator on the left. When your ride comes to a stop and you exit the elevator; you need to walk left one screen, go up the elevator, and then walk right three screens. (You are now in the armory of the Deltaur battle cruiser.) Walk up to the counter, and type SHOW CARD when prompted by the robot. Then, when he is in the back room, quickly walk over to the side of the counter and type GET GRENADE (You have to be sure and get it before he comes back in the room. When he does come back in, he'll give you a weapon and a new option will come up on screen. From now on, you can fire your pistol at any time by pressing the F6 button.) Exit this room via the left doorway. Walk to the midpoint of the catwalk and stop. When you are directly over the Sarien guarding the Star Generator below, type DROP THE GRENADE (The grenade will release poisonous gas into the lungs of the guard below. Now access to the Star Generator is free and clear.) Now, go right one screen and re-enter the armory room. Again, type SHOW THE CARD to once again ask the robot for a gun. Then, once again, walk over to the side and take another grenade while he is in the back room. (The robot will not give you another weapon, but that's okay because you really just wanted another grenade.) Now, walk left three screens. (When you step into the third screen, Roger will trip and his helmet will roll into the elevator, never to be seen again. You didn't do anything wrong, this will always happen no matter what you do. Unfortunately, this means that you will now have to shoot every Sarien guard you run into from now on. Stay Alert!) So now, go down the elevator. When you exit the elevator on the bottom floor, go right two screens. (Don't forget to kill any and all guards you may run into.) Walk up to the dead guard and type SEARCH BODY Then, type PRESS BUTTON (The button you just pressed on the device you just took will shut off the force field around the Star Generator, which makes the small control panel accessible.) Walk up the set of pink stairs that lead to the Star Generator and type in LOOK AT PANEL From here, you need to use the arrow keys along with the F6 button to enter the digits 6858. (This will start the automatic self-destruct sequence of the Star Generator, which means it's time for you to get moving.) Go left one screen. (Keep in mind that as you make your way to the end, you need to kill at least one guard with your ray gun. It counts as three points.) Enter into the first elevator you come to. When you get out, quickly step into the elevator on your right. Once it takes you to the shuttle room, walk past the red gate, down the three blue steps, and up to the shuttle on the left side of the screen. Type GET IN THE SHIP Type LAUNCH (K-A-B-O-O-M. Congratulations, you have just escaped the Sarien ship. You saved your own ass, and more importantly the entire galaxy, from the threat of Sarien aggression. You should be proud of yourself!!!) ======================================================================= |-V.----------------------- EASTER EGG LIST --------------------------| ======================================================================= Here are a few little amusing things you might have missed: 1. The Blues Brothers can be seen playing in the bar on the Ulence Flats, as well as the band ZZ Top. 2. Written in graffiti on the outside wall of the bar is "Xenon Bites" written in the Sarien language. Xenon is your home planet, and also the birthplace of the Star Generator. 3. The "Droids B Us" store sounds like "Toys R Us". Another interesting fact; the real life "Toys R Us" corporation sued Sierra On-Line for use of their company name. 4. The doctor on the data cartridge, Dr Slash Vohaul, shares a similar name to the evil leader of the Sarien, Sludge Vohaul. Could they possibly be brothers? 5. The Sarien guard you talk to in the Deltaur will ask you about a game called King's Quest III. Sierra On-Line, who is also the creator of this game, created the King's Quest series. 6. When you press the "Don't Touch" button on the first escape shuttle, you will be transported to an area of King's Quest I. (You'll still die though, so don't try it without saving first.) 7. When you break the slot machine in the bar, it will give you a message saying that the Gippazoid Corporation is the manufacturer. This company will appear again in Space Quest II, III, and V. 8. Not really something you can find in the game, but the original name of this game was going to be "Star Quest" 9. The planet Kerona is a spoof on a reported alien crash site in 1987. 10. The Star Generator that is the main idea of the plot to the game is very similar to the Death Star from the "Star Wars" movies. ======================================================================= |-VI.----------------------- THE POINT LIST --------------------------| ======================================================================= There are a total of 202 points that can be earned in this game, and this list will tell you how to get every last one. =-Aboard the Starship Arcada-= Get the keycard - 1 Look at the old man - 2 Get the data cartridge - 5 Open the bay doors - 2 Use the keycard - 2 Get the new suit - 2 Get the device - 2 Raise the platform - 1 Push the Autonav button - 2 Escape the Arcade - 15 ---------------------------------------- =-The Planet of Kerona-= Get the survival kit - 2 Get the piece of glass - 3 Use the rock to kill spider - 5 Take elevator underground - 2 Put the rock in the steam - 4 Destroy the lasers - 5 Safely pass the acid drops - 3 Kill Orat with water - 5 Get the Orat part - 2 Drop the Orat part - 10 Put the cartridge in the slot - 5 Take the cartridge out of the slot - 5 ---------------------------------------- =-The Settlement on The Ulence Flats-= Complete the skimmer ride - 25 Sell skimmer on the 2nd offer - 5 Overhear where the bar conversation - 5 Buy the spaceship - 4 Buy the robot - 4 ---------------------------------------- =-Attack on the Sarien Battle Cruiser-= Fly to sector HH - 25 Enter the Deltaur - 1 Climb into the chest - 3 Climb into the washing machine - 5 Talk to the Sarien guard - 1 Kiss the Sarien guard - 1 Answer yes to the guard's question - 5 Get the gas grenade - 1 Get the ray gun - 3 Drop the gas grenade on the guard - 5 Get another has grenade - 1 Search the body of the dead guard - 3 Press the ON button of device - 3 Use gun to kill a Sarien guard - 3 Enter 6856 into Star Generator - 10 Enter the elevator to the escape pod - 1 Fly out of the Deltaur - 3 ---------------------------------------- ======================================================================= |-VII.---------------------- SPECIAL THANKS --------------------------| ======================================================================= Thank you Sierra On-Line for creating this, and all of the other installments in the Space Quest series of games.
